Best Bay Area Tours...
San Francisco, located in the beautiful Bay Area of California, is a city known for its iconic landmarks, diverse culture, and stunning views. With so much to see and do in this vibrant city, taking a guided tour can be a great way to make the most o...
San Francisco, United States